The test technique described in BS **6 part 6 provides a
comparative measurement of the contribution to the spread of fire
made by an essentially flat material, composite, or assembly. The
test result is reported as a fire propagation index. Its main
purpose is to evaluate the effectiveness of internal wall and
ceiling linings.

Product Information
The BS ****6 test method is a technique for figuring out a
material's flame propagation characteristics. It is mostly used to
assess how well wall and ceiling linings function in a fire. Flame
propagation index is used to express the results. The test object
was exposed to a tube torch during which time the lamp released **0
J/m of heat. The two electric heaters' combined wattage was set to
***0 watts at the end of the test's 2 minutes and *5 seconds. The
power was decreased to ***0 watts after the first five minutes of
the test and stayed there until the test was finished. The test
took *0 minutes to complete.
